SARCA: Skeletal Muscle Health, Arthritis, Respiratory and Cardiovascular Health

SARCA consists of three interdisciplinary special interest research groups that collaborate to achieve two key objectives; firstly, to promote skeletal muscle, respiratory and cardio-metabolic health across the lifespan, and secondly, to investigate the therapeutic utility of exercise, physical activity and nutritional interventions for associated non-communicable diseases.
